The 445 nm 250 W High Power Fiber Coupled Blue Laser is an ultra-high-output visible light source engineered to solve the “reflectivity barrier” in industrial manufacturing. While standard infrared lasers struggle with non-ferrous metals, this blue laser module provides the unrivaled energy absorption required for high-speed, spatter-free welding of copper, gold, and aluminum—making it the essential core for EV battery production and power electronics. Delivering a massive 250 W of continuous-wave output through a high-brightness 105 µm core, the K445 series utilizes an advanced four-submodule architecture to ensure absolute spectral stability and power consistency. Built for 24/7 heavy industrial environments, this water-cooled system features integrated thermal tracking and a 635 nm visible aiming beam for precise alignment. Terminated with a rugged HP-SMA905 interface, it represents the technical standard for high-power additive manufacturing (SLM), metal cladding, and advanced scientific research.

SPECIFICATIONS ( 20°C ) SYMBOL UNIT K445HR6FN-250.0W
MINIMUM TYPICAL MAXIMUM
OPTICAL
DATA(1)
Total CW Output Power Po W 250
Center Wavelength λc nm 445 ± 20
Spectral Width (FWHM) Δλ nm 6
Wavelength Shift / Temp Δλ/ΔT nm/°C 0.1
Sub-module Count pcs 4
ELECTRICAL
DATA
Electrical-to-Optical Efficiency PE % 30
Threshold Current Ith A 0.35
Operating Current (single module) Iop A 3.5 3.8
Operating Voltage (single module) Vop V 52 60
FIBER
DATA
Core Diameter Dcore μm 105
Numeric Aperture NA 0.22
Fiber Length Lf m 2.0
Fiber Termination HP-SMA905
THERMAL &
OTHERS
Cooling Method Water Cooling
Cooling Capacity W ≥500
Cooling Water Temperature T °C 20 ± 5
Water Discharge L/min 7
COMPONENTS Thermistor (Resistance) Rt K Ω 10 ± 3%
OTHERS ESD Vesd V 500
Storage Temperature(2) Tst °C -20 70
Operating Case Temp(3) Top °C 20 30
Relative Humidity RH % 15 75
